Madras HC slams PWD, forest dept for letting encroachers erect solar fence in reserved forest areas in Erode, Coimbatore |
The Madras High Court criticized the Public Works and Forest department for allowing encroachers to put up solar fences in reserved forest and water spread area in Tamil Nadu's Erode and Coimbatore districts. The court has directed the forest department to take immediate steps to remove them. The court was hearing a public interest litigation, seeking a direction to the authorities to clear and prevent encroachments in future in the reserved forest areas. The bench posted the matter for hearing on 25th of next month.
